APE audio is what actually exists here, and it gets encoded straight into a MKV media container. No artwork or motion is invented, so the resulting MKV file can carry no meaningful video stream at all. Monkey's Audio input is expanded through its lossless frame and seek-table structure before sample depth, channels, cues, and tags can be compared. Matroska delivery can retain multiple timed tracks, languages, subtitles, chapters, and attachments, though simplified writers and browser players may use only a subset.

APE playback and seeking are less broadly supported than FLAC, especially on browsers and mobile devices.
A simplified conversion may keep only primary streams, and many browsers do not play MKV directly.
The verified MKV profile uses H.264 video and Opus audio when those streams are present.
Decode and compare duration, sample rate, bit depth, channels, sample integrity, tags, and seeking performance.
Inspect the stream list, subtitles, language labels, chapters, seeking, and sync.
Use this route only when the receiving workflow specifically accepts audio inside MKV. It is not a music-visualizer or slideshow generator.
